South Kashmir: Forces ‘ransack’ shops after locals celebrate Pakistan Champions Trophy win

Government forces on Monday night allegedly vandalized dozens of shops and vehicles in Vehil village of Shopian after locals burst firecrackers to celebrate Pakistan’s win over Sri Lanka in the ongoing Champions Trophy in England.

Local sources said that youth burst firecrackers to celebrate the Pakistan cricket team at around 10:30 pm last night.

 However, forces personnel rushed to the village and fired several rounds in air soon after the celebrations.

Sources said that forces personnel ransacked shops and smashed the windowpanes of houses.image

Many shopkeepers alleged that their merchandise was missing following the raid.

Locals took to streets today morning and staged massive protests against the government forces.

SP Shopian A S Dinkar said he would ascertain what has happened in the village. ( Source Greater Kashmir )
